This Vintage-Looking adidas Superstar Is One of the Best We’ve Seen

The adidas Superstar recently celebrated its 50th-anniversary, meaning we were treated to collaborations with the likes of Prada and Sean Wotherspoon, as well as a slew of general release colorways, many of which did the iconic silhouette more than justice. That being said, we might be seeing the best Superstar in a while in 2022, if the above, leaked product images are anything to go by.

Apparently, adidas Originals will be releasing a Superstar that pairs a vintage, pre-worn look with pops of retro red. The sneaker’s midsole is slightly yellowed, as are the laces and the shell toe. The white leather base looks like it’s constructed of higher-quality leather. To finish it off, the sneaker features pops of fuzzy red suede on the heel tab and Three Stripes branding, as well as red accents on the sock liner.

There’s no word yet on when exactly this Superstar will be released, though it’s highly likely we’ll see it at some point in early 2022. Stay tuned for more information.
